What are the most common Dodge repair issues you see in Tenants Harbor due to our local climate and roads?

Given our coastal environment and winter road conditions, we frequently address rust-related brake and exhaust system issues, as well as problems stemming from potholes like suspension components (ball joints, tie rods) and wheel alignments on Dodge trucks and SUVs. Cold starts can also exacerbate battery and electrical gremlins in older models.

Are repair parts for Dodge vehicles readily available in the Tenants Harbor area, or should I expect delays?

While local shops have good connections with regional suppliers, some specific OEM parts for Dodge models may not be in immediate stock and require ordering from larger distributors, potentially causing a 1-2 day delay. A reputable shop will communicate this upfront and may offer quality aftermarket alternatives to get you back on the road faster.

What is a general price range for common Dodge repairs like brake service or suspension work in this area?

Pricing varies by model, but for a standard brake job (pads and rotors) on a Dodge Ram or Durango, expect a range of $300-$600 per axle, while suspension repairs like strut replacement can range from $500-$900. Always request a detailed written estimate that includes parts and labor specific to your vehicle's issue.
